会员中心
网站首页 > 编程助手 > 台湾中文娱乐在线天堂 深入解析高等数学编程:无穷级数的奥秘与应用

台湾中文娱乐在线天堂 深入解析高等数学编程:无穷级数的奥秘与应用

在线计算网 · 发布于 2025-03-19 04:22:03 · 已经有12人使用

台湾中文娱乐在线天堂 深入解析高等数学编程:无穷级数的奥秘与应用

引言

无穷级数是高等数学中的重要概念,广泛应用于编程和实际问题解决。本文将带你深入理解无穷级数的原理及其在编程中的应用。

什么是无穷级数

无穷级数是指由无穷多个项组成的数列之和。形式上可以表示为: $$ \sum_{n=0}^{\infty} a_n $$ 其中,$a_n$ 是级数的第 $n$ 项。

无穷级数的收敛与发散

收敛性

一个无穷级数如果其部分和的极限存在且有限,则称该级数收敛。例如,几何级数 $\sum_{n=0}^{\infty} ar^n$ 在 $|r| < 1$ 时收敛。

发散性

如果部分和的极限不存在或无限大,则称该级数发散。例如,调和级数 $\sum_{n=1}^{\infty} \frac{1}{n}$ 是发散的。

无穷级数在编程中的应用

求和计算

在编程中,我们可以使用循环或递归来计算无穷级数的部分和。以下是一个Python示例,计算几何级数的部分和:


def geometric_series(a, r, n):
    sum = 0
    for i in range(n):
        sum += a * (r ** i)
    return sum

print(geometric_series(1, 0.5, 10))  ## 输出:1.998046875

数值分析

无穷级数常用于数值分析中的近似计算。例如,使用泰勒级数近似计算 $e^x$:


import math

def taylor_series_e(x, n):
    sum = 0
    for i in range(n):
        sum += x ** i / math.factorial(i)
    return sum

print(taylor_series_e(1, 10))  ## 输出:2.7182818011463845

实际案例分析

金融计算

在金融中,无穷级数可以用于计算复利。假设年利率为 $r$,本金为 $P$,则 $n$ 年后的本息和为: $$ A = P \sum_{n=0}^{\infty} (1 + r)^n $$

物理模拟

在物理中,无穷级数用于模拟波动现象。例如,傅里叶级数将周期函数分解为正弦和余弦函数的和。

总结

无穷级数不仅是高等数学的基础,也是编程中解决实际问题的重要工具。通过本文的学习,希望你能更好地理解和应用无穷级数,提升编程技能。

参考文献

  • 高等数学教程

  • Python编程指南

微信扫码
X

更快、更全、更智能
微信扫码使用在线科学计算器

Copyright © 2022 www.tampocvet.com All Rights Reserved.
在线计算网版权所有严禁任何形式复制 粤ICP备20010675号 本网站由智启CMS强力驱动网站地图